The blurb:

"Acheron is a Grimpunk table top role-playing game where you must sacrifice your humanity to fight against the evils of the world. Mystery, monsters, and magic collide in this 1930s era setting where The Government controls the path of History, Factions war for resources, and The Wall looms forever upon the horizon. Are you another cog in the great machine of society, or will you forge your own destiny in the bustling city streets and ancient places once lost to time as history, for the first time in living memory, can be uncovered once more."

Highlights:

1930's Grimpunk setting: Many people say it feels like Dishonored 100 years in the future.

Classless progression system: Why not be a blind gunslinger?

Simplified Realism/Gritty Combat: We're a Biologist, Engineer, and Anthropologist so we like to keep things feeling as real as possible. This includes getting killed when shot with a Desert Eagle.

Die Hard: Lose a limb to stay alive. It may be a worthy trade.

Sanity: Lose your mind...A little bit at a time...Or a lot at a time! The world is full of horrors after all.
